Transaction 0140c888ec504a8153d0619ef88ccc572f731f4230563a35dfc8f46b785b6a16
1 Input
1 Output
-
0140c888ec504a8153d0619ef88ccc572f731f4230563a35dfc8f46b785b6a16:0
- value
- 289319703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07d0a3980e30848b197becacbd72cedb7e8f389 OP_EQUAL
- address
- MSuYaFw1cf2RjfcoH7nrrW6F1KhSEY9gTn